Corazón de Onix

Heart of Onix
Written in:
2005
Duration:
15'
Instrumentation:
flute (+piccolo, alto & bass flute), clarinet (+bass clarinet), piano, violin, viola, cello
Commisioned by

Commissioned by Onix Ensemble, with funds provided by FONCA (Mexico).

Premiere

Premiered on 20th May 2006 at Sala Blas Galindo, Mexico City by Ensemble Onix conducted by Jose Luis Castillo.

Programme Note

The title of the piece refers to the harshness of the stone, which despite being so hard lends itself to be sculpted into many shapes including producing wonderful sounds when turned into wind chimes, as they often do in Mexico.
